St Elian's (or Elian's) Church in located in the village of Llaneilian on Anglesey, and is not only one of the earliest ecclesiastical sites on Anglesey, but also one that has very many artefacts and furniture of interest still surviving. Not least of these is the 15th century rood screen, in remarkably good order. The skeleton above - which is a painting on the rood screen - has the welsh inscription "Colyn angau yw pechod" - translates as "The sting of death is sin".

Although there has been some kind of religious cell on this site since the 5th century, the church tower and steeple are the oldest parts of the present building, and they date from the 12th century. The remining parts of the church date mostly from the 15th and 17th centuries.
